Output 41690b1dfa8251932ed56a5a16c8cc7d83a49fef60c1170556dfd1bf3e2262aa:10

value
261354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99b2f325f2c8affdf5706245e71df7fe68a1e508 OP_EQUAL
address
3FhhgYVNxprbKy2P6myzC8TwUQhMbU4h4a
transaction
41690b1dfa8251932ed56a5a16c8cc7d83a49fef60c1170556dfd1bf3e2262aa
spent
true